Genxai Analytics Ltd. IPO

IPO Date: Jun 5 to Jun 9 2026

Objective

1. Funding Working Capital requirement of our Company.
2. Repayment and / or prepayment in part or full of its outstanding borrowings.
3. Capital expenditure to meet expenses for development of new products.
4. General Corporate Purposes.

IPO Details

Face Value ₹ 10.00 Per Share
Issue Size ₹ 52.01 - 54.84 Cr
Price Band ₹ 110.00 - ₹ 116.00 Per Share
Market LOT 2400 shares
Issue Type Book building

About Company

We are a technology-driven provider of enterprise performance and analytics solutions that enable organisations to streamline workflows, improve system performance, and enhance operational efficiency. We integrate data and processes across finance, sales, operations, customer management and human resources into unified systems, enabling teams to work with a single source of information and make operational decisions more efficiently.

COMPANY Posted on May 30th 2026

Jyoti CNC Automation - Quaterly Results

The revenue for the March 2026 quarter is pegged at Rs. 5987.00 millions, about 13.15% up against Rs. 5291.00 millions recorded during the year-ago period.Modest increase of 10.76% in the Net Profit was reported from. 1219.10 millions to Rs. 1350.30  millions.Operating profit for the quarter ended March 2026 rose to 2139.60 millions as compared to 1837.40 millions of corresponding quarter ended March 2025.

COMPANY Posted on May 30th 2026

Aegis Logistics - Quaterly Results

The topline surged 87.38% to Rs. 17131.60 millions for the March 2026 quarter as against Rs. 9142.50 millions during the corresponding quarter last year.Net Profit witnessed a 132.37% growth almost the double from Rs. 2256.40 millions to Rs. 5243.10  millions  of same quarter last year.Operating Profit saw a handsome growth to 6547.70 millions from 2820.60 millions in the quarter ended March 2026.

An Initial Public Offering (IPO) is when a private company sells shares to the public for the first time, enabling investors to purchase these shares and gain partial ownership in the business. For instance, if a well-known tech firm wants to grow and requires additional funds, it might choose to go public through an IPO. During this process, investors can buy shares, and the company’s stock starts trading on the stock exchange on the day of the IPO listing.

Investors can apply for an IPO through their bank or brokerage account. Many trading platforms have a specific section for IPOs where users can submit their applications online.

The primary market is where shares are offered to the public for the first time via an IPO. After the IPO, shares are traded on the secondary market (stock exchange), where existing shareholders can sell to new buyers.

Investing in an IPO offers the opportunity to become an early investor in companies with high growth potential, at a price which may be lower than their post-listing market value. It provides a chance to participate in the company's growth journey from its early stages. However, IPO investments also come with inherent risks, such as market volatility and uncertainties about the company's future performance.

The price of an IPO is established through a systematic process known as "book building." In this method, investors bid within a given price range, and the final price is set based on demand and market conditions. Several factors play a crucial role in determining the IPO price, including:

Past Financial Performance: Evaluating the company's revenue, profits, and financial stability over time

Growth Potential: Assessing future prospects based on the company's business model and market opportunities

Industry Peers: Comparing valuation metrics with similar companies in the same sector

Larger Industry Picture: Analysing overall industry trends and economic conditions that could impact the company's performance

The lock-in period for IPO shares refers to a duration during which specific investors are restricted from selling their shares post-listing. This period varies based on the type of investor:

Promoters: The lock-in period for promoters ranges from 6 months to 18 months, ensuring their commitment to the company's long-term growth

Anchor Investors: Typically, anchor investors face a shorter lock-in period of 30 to 90 days, depending on regulatory norms and the specific IPO

IPOs can be volatile and may not perform as expected in the short term. Investors risk losing capital if the stock price drops after listing, especially if the company does not meet its growth projections.

Eligibility for an IPO typically includes:

Retail Investors: Individuals who invest in smaller amounts, usually under the “retail investor” category, with certain limits

Qualified Institutional Buyers (QIBs): Entities like mutual funds, banks, and insurance companies, who invest large sums

Non-Institutional Investors (NIIs): High-net-worth individuals or entities investing above the retail threshold

Investors must have a Demat and trading account to apply, and in some cases, certain financial or residency qualifications may apply depending on local regulations.

SME (Small and Medium Enterprise) IPOs generally carry higher risk but may provide significant growth potential. Investors should research the company’s stability, financials, and sector risks, as SME stocks can be more volatile compared to large-cap companies.
